Descrizione The Thesis is part of a project on image processing for facial expression recognition. The purpose is to perform an automatic detection of emotions from pictures or videos recorded on consumer-grade devices.
In more detail, the candidate will:
1) Analyse images (RGB and grayscale) and videos included in publicly available datasets,
2) Localise facial landmarks through specific processing libraries,
3) Pre-process the extracted data to identify a smaller subset that effectively characterises facial expressions and emotional features,
4) Build a framework for lightweight, automatic detection of emotions from the selected facial landmarks. Machine or Deep Learning approaches are encouraged.

Conoscenze richieste Knowledge of Python, C++, or Matlab. Interest in Artificial Intelligence applications. Basic knowledge of Image and/or Signal Processing.
